President Donald Trump is expected to name Rebecca Burch, executive director of EY’s Washington Council, to be deputy assistant secretary for international tax affairs at the Treasury Department.
Two people familiar with the matter told Bloomberg Tax about the plans to appoint Burch. The post was held by Scott Levine during the Biden administration.
In her new role, Burch will serve as top US delegate on tax matters at the Organization for Economic Cooperation and Development, representing the US in negotiations with other countries on global tax standards and, importantly, the international tax deal.
